Output 6990a36aeab24dedc873d88f65721b3716fb73b52094c4c0b107471713873899:22

value
19683
script pubkey
OP_0 OP_PUSHBYTES_20 fe661b11377a832ec39ebf1f1accfd18d7582ccd
address
tb1qlenpkyfh02pjasu7hu034n8arrt4stxdgw0l9w
transaction
6990a36aeab24dedc873d88f65721b3716fb73b52094c4c0b107471713873899